Samsung Soul 3G 5MP Cell Phone launches in Europe


Samsung announces the launch of the feature packed Samsung Soul in Europe. In good Korean electronics company tradition they published some sexy Gadget Model photos with the Soul announcement.

Feature highlights of the Quad-Band HSDPA 7.2 Mbps Samsung Soul include 5MP Camera with AF, 4x digital zoom, Power LED light, Face detection, image stabilizer, 2.2 inch QVGA screen, Bluetooth 2.0, MP3 and WMA music player and ICEpower Technology by B&O.
All these great features are packed in a full metal body with a premium finish, which is only 12.9mm thin. Overall measurements of the Samsung Soul are 105.9x49.5x12.9mm.

The most obvious new feature is the Magical Touch by DaCP navigation indicators on the keypad of the Soul. The indicators change according to your needs, making navigation of the menus simple and intuitive. See this video demonstrating the new cool UI of the Samsung Soul.

The Samsung Soul will start to ship in May starting in Britain, France, Germany, the Netherlands and Belgium. There will be three colors of the Samsung Soul available: Steel Sterling, Soul Gray and Platinum Silver.
Samsung unveiled the Samsung Soul Ultra Edition mobile phone at the Mobile World Congress earlier this year.

World's Largest Liger(Lion+Tiger)

You Know what's a Liger? It's a cross breed of a Lion male and Tiger female...


The 10ft Liger who's still growing...


He looks like something from a prehistoric age or a fantastic creation from Hollywood . But Hercules is very much living flesh and blood - as he proves every time he opens his gigantic mouth to roar. Part lion, part tiger, he is not just a big cat but a huge one, standing 10ft tall on his back legs. Called a liger, in reference to his crossbreed parentage, he is the largest of all the cat species.


On a typical day he will devour 20lb of meat, usually beef or chicken, and is capable of eating 100lb at a single setting. At just three years old, Hercules already weighs half a ton.


He is the accidental result of two enormous big cats living close together at the Institute of Greatly Endangered and Rare Species, in Miami, Florida , and already dwarfs both his parents.


"Ligers are not something we planned on having," said institute owner Dr Bhagavan Antle. "We have lions and tigers living together in large enclosures and at first we had no idea how well one of the lion boys was getting along with a tiger girl, then loo and behold we had a liger."


50mph runner... Not only that, but he likes to swim, a feat unheard of among water-fearing lions. In the wild it is virtually impossible for lions and tigers to mate. Not only are they enemies likely to kill one  another, but most lions are in Africa and most tigers in Asia . But incredible though he is, Hercules is not unique. Ligers have been bred in captivity, deliberately and accidentally, since shortly before World War II.


Today there are believed to be a handful of ligers around the world and a similar number of tigons, the product of a tiger father and lion mother. Tigons are smaller than ligers and take on more physical
characteristics of the tiger.


The Tiger Temple in Thailand

A place where tourists can pet tigers just like they do their cats, here's something you don't see every day.

The Tiger Temple, or Wat Pha Luang Ta Bua is Theravada Buddhist forest temple, in Thailand. It has been a sanctuary for many endangered animals for quite some time now, including several tigers. It was founded in 1994 as a forest monastery, where animals could find sanctuary and in 1999 they received their first tiger cub, which died soon after.


But they kept receiving tiger cubs from the villagers who probably encountered them wondering through the forest after their mothers were killed by poachers.


The Tiger has raised money over the years and can now accommodate 12 mature tigers and 4 cubs. they live in cages and once a day they are taken to a nearby quarry, where they can roam freely.


Tourists may watch from 10 meters distance and sometimes they are allowed to pet these
magnificent creatures. Only one serious attack took place in the history of the temple.


The priests at the Tiger Temple are now gathering funds to build a larger facility and create an almost natural environment for the animals, so they can one day be let out into the wild where they belong.


In case you're wondering, yes this is the place
featured on Animal Planet.
